In 2018, Ozanam Charitable Pharmacy dispensed over 31,000 prescriptions to over 1690 individuals in their 4-county service area. These prescriptions had a retail value of $2.8 million. Ozanam serves qualified adults between the ages of 19-65 who have no insurance and are unable to afford life-sustaining prescription medications. These local residents are often working 2 or 3 jobs but still may have to make the choice between prescription medications or putting food on the table for their families.
